Boson Method not Violating the Pauli Principle Applied to the Three-Quasiparticle System
The boson method is studied for a system with one and three quasiparticles. A basis is constructed in the ideal space in such a way that the Pauli principle is fully satisfied. The spurious states due to the particle nonconservation are properly eliminated. Numerical calculations are presented and a comparison is made with Kuo's method. The boson method can be easily extended to the study of systems having two phonons.
